Wednesday, December 12, 2012

Studio Project 1




Model: Alex Koot
Lightroom: On every picture, the contrast and brightness was shot up so the back drop is vibrant. But that caused a white and too bright of a face. Then the brush tool was used to darken the face back. Clarity went all the way down to smooth the face, contrast was pushed down also to take the over-dramatic highlights off of the face, exposure and brightness were pushed down slightly so the face went back to skin color, but not too much or else it would look grainy and dark brown, and lastly, sharpness was pushed all the way up to finish it off.
